NEW DELHI, May 2, 2023 /PRNewswire/ — PHD Chamber of Commerce and Industry (PHDCCI), in collaboration with Association Internationale du Film d’Animation (Asifa) India, has organized a festival on Animation, Visual Effects, Gaming and Comics (AVGC) titled Pix-Elated 2023. The festival was a significant milestone in PHDCCI’s ‘Create in India‘ mission to promote high-quality content that showcases India’s diverse culture, heritage, and folk art globally, while also facilitating international co-productions to support the growth of the Indian AVGC industry.

The festival witnessed an exciting line-up of activities, including behind-the-scenes VFX stories of famous international movies, sessions with animation and gaming gurus, workshops on storytelling, sculpting, and photography, special sessions with women animators, art-based competitions, VR experience zone, food stalls, and music. The event aimed to inspire and empower creators to tell stories that capture the spirit of India and showcase Indian talent to the world.

The event was addressed by various industry experts, including Ms. Vrinda Sood, Co-Chairperson, PHDCCI AVGC Sub-committee, Ms. Shalini Sharma, Assistant Secretary General, PHDCCI, Mr. Saurabh Sanyal, CEO & Secretary-General, PHDCCI, Mr. Sanjay Khimesara, President, Asifa India, Mr. Sandeep Marwah, Chairman, Entertainment & AVGC Committee, PHDCCI, Ms. Charuvi Agrawal, Chairperson, PHDCCI AVGC Sub-committee, Ms. Kanchan Prasad, Additional Director General, Prasar Bharti, and many more dignitaries from the industry. During the event, Mr. Virendra Kishore talked about parts of Netflix’s Stranger Things Season 4 which were done at DNEG in India. The event aimed to inspire and empower creators to showcase India’s diverse culture, heritage, and folk art globally, promoting India’s soft power through the AVGC industry.

Pix-Elated 2023 addressed the need for India to become a global AVGC hub by adopting technology and upgrading skills constantly. The initiative highlighted the growing demand for talent, especially in the gaming space, and how people are needed in all sectors and sub-sectors in AVGC, including 2D animation. Emphasising on the need for tremendous government support, industry experts also requested the government of Delhi and other neighbouring states to offer incentives towards funding IP linked projects, skill development, real estate, and hardware/software requirements, on the lines of states such as Telangana, Karnataka, Maharashtra, etc. The AVGC sector is seen as a unique  opportunity for India to promote its soft power, similar to the way the US did through Hollywood.

About Association Internationale du Film d’ Animation (Asifa) India:

Asifa (Association Internationale du Film d’Animation) was founded in 1960 in Annecy, France as an association of individual animation artists. ASIFA India received its official charter on November 25, 2000, and it aspires to the same ideals and goals as the international organization. In this spirit, throughout the year, ASIFA India is involved in a lot of activities. Today, ASIFA is at the forefront of International Animation Day every 28th October, facilitating film exchanges around the globe and encouraging celebrations of the art of animation in every local chapter.
